where can i get this emote? not seen it in store but it gets used against me a lot by cactusjack350090210 in MarvelSnap

[–]MFFMemes -1 points0 points  (0 children)

For context to anyone not around back then: The emote was originally going to be the final reward for top players in their respective leagues in the first League event, a limited time game mode that has been phased out. Players, however, found an exploit whereby they could earn points towards advancing in their leagues by simply spamming play-and-retreat games in Proving Grounds. A lot of leagues were being dominated by players using that exploit, which understandably upset everyone else. The devs didn't realize that they had set up a points system that could be easily exploited, of course, so they decided to give the Deadpool enote to everyone with an account at the time. The end result was that roughly 90% more players have it than otherwise would have, which means that conversely it would be at least 90% rarer today if the devs hadn't screwed up (just imagine!).
